R Applications in Earth Sciences

From Soil Data to Climate Time Series Analysis and Modeling

This textbook helps to understand the real Earth data with the practical application of many handy R tools and techniques. R language and thousands of R packages can be used to solve the most sophisticated scientific problems. The book provides insights to the various approaches to Earth-related data analysis, starting from data preparation and validation, exploratory data analysis, linear regression, and going through time series decomposition, modeling, and prediction. In addition, the book introduces machine learning techniques and their application to some real problems. Along with a profound explanation of the datasets and theoretical considerations of the methods, the book offers a way of solving practical problems lying at the frontline of modern data analysis in physical geography, soils, and climate science.
